Rails 3模型生成器与关联

时间:2013-08-15 09:45:20

标签: ruby-on-rails-3 activerecord associations

我有一个名为User的模型。是否在rails generator命令行中有任何选项可以为模型添加关联。例如,我想创建一个名为Pet的新模型,我希望宠物属于UserUser有许多Pets。有没有选项可以自动生成这些关联。

1 个答案:

答案 0 :(得分:1)

好吧,不是你想要的所有东西,但是在命令下面会产生belongs_to关联。

rails generate Model Pet user:references

它还会在宠物表中创建user_id字段以进行关联。 您必须手动将has_many添加到用户模型。